Handicap Ramp Repair in Denver, CO
Handicap ramp repair services focus on restoring and maintaining accessibility features for homes and properties. These projects typ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or worn ramps, ensuring they meet safety standards and provide reliable access for individuals with mobility challenges. Property owners often request this service when ramps become unstable, cracked, or worn over time, or after weather events that cause damage. Understanding the scope of repairs needed, the types of materials used, and the importance of a secure, level surface are common considerations before requesting service.
Property owners should consider factors such as the current condition of the ramp, the extent of damage, and any specific accessibility requirements. It’s helpful to know whether repairs involve simple fixes like patching or more extensive work such as replacing sections of the structure. Clarifying these details can ensure the repair process addresses safety, durability, and compliance with accessibility needs, providing peace of mind for those relying on the ramp for daily mobility.

Common Handicap Ramp Repair Jobs
Handicap Ramp Repair - restores safety and accessibility to existing ramps for improved mobility.
Ramp Surface Repair - fixes cracks, holes, and uneven surfaces to prevent tripping hazards.
Structural Reinforcement - strengthens weakened ramps to ensure stability and support.
Slope Adjustment - modifies ramp angles to meet accessibility standards and homeowner needs.
Handrail Replacement - updates or repairs handrails for enhanced safety and support.
Custom Ramp Modifications - adapts ramps to fit specific property layouts and accessibility requirements.
Handicap Ramp Repair Questions
What types of handicap ramp repairs are commonly needed? Repairs often include fixing loose or damaged handrails, replacing worn-out decking, and correcting slope issues for safety and accessibility.
How can I tell if my handicap ramp needs repair? Signs include wobbling, cracks, uneven surfaces, or difficulty in maintaining stability when using the ramp.
Are modifications needed for different types of properties? Yes, repairs are tailored to various property types, including residential homes, apartments, and commercial buildings, to meet accessibility standards.
What materials are used for handicap ramp repairs? Common materials include durable wood, composite decking, and metal components to ensure longevity and safety.
